Handover for the weekly eng sync: I'm transferring ownership of Duskrunner, our nightly backfill scheduler, to Priya. Current state: all jobs healthy except the ledger-reconciliation backfill, which retries once nightly due to a slow upstream from the Kestwick warehouse. Retry logic, window sizing, and concurrency caps were all tuned carefully last quarter — please don't change them without a load test. For full transparency at the sync, the production instance runs with these configuration values.

settings of hawep-kadug:
RALAEL_HOST=ralael.tolvaqlabs.internal
RALAEL_PORT=9000

Before enabling it, export your existing allowlist and convert it with the bundled translator, since Quillguard uses normalized package names rather than raw strings. Run the scanner in report-only mode for at least one sprint and review flagged packages with the registry team before switching to blocking mode. Misconfigured edit-distance thresholds are the most common source of false positives, so verify them carefully. Apply the following baseline configuration to begin.

config for yadug-tahag:
DRUIX_HOST=druix.lumicsys.internal
DRUIX_PORT=9300

# Quick note for whoever inherits this: `tailpup` is our internal CLI
# for streaming logs out of the Brindlewick aggregator. It batches by
# default, so add --raw if you need line-by-line output during an
# incident. The client below talks to the Brindlewick gateway directly,
# skipping the proxy, which is why startup feels instant. It won't
# connect to anything until you set the key that goes right here:

gateway credential: kto23_LX9A4ys6i4nzHtpOLNLodKK

**Ticket #: Vault locked after image-slimming rollout — Ostrel Build Team**

While trimming the base image for the Calverno deploy pipeline, we removed the vault client's helper binaries, which caused three failed unseal attempts and locked the secrets vault. Functionality is restored in the slimmed image, but the vault remains locked pending manual recovery. Per policy, a reviewer must confirm the lockout cause before unsealing. To proceed, unseal with the passphrase provided below.

unlock words, bahap-bajof: sorax-giliel-quenwyn